I create a new DVD project and add one or more file(s) to it. Pressing the "Burn" button results in a crash. Reproducible: Always Steps to Reproduce: 1.start k3b 2.create a new DVD data project 3.add 1 file to it 4.press "burn" button (the one at lower right edge of the window) Actual Results: Crash. Pop up of KDE Crashmanager. Expected Results: The burn dialog should pop up. Traceback of crash manager: -------------------------- cut ------------------------ Using host libthread_db library "/lib/libthread_db.so.1". [Thread debugging using libthread_db enabled] [New Thread 16384 (LWP 32747)] [KCrash handler] #5 0xb7c80af2 in K3bWriterSelectionWidget::slotRefreshWriterSpeeds() () from /usr/lib/libk3bproject.so.2 #6 0xb7c80622 in K3bWriterSelectionWidget::init() () from /usr/lib/libk3bproject.so.2 #7 0xb7c8024b in K3bWriterSelectionWidget::K3bWriterSelectionWidget(bool, QWidget*, char const*) () from /usr/lib/libk3bproject.so.2 #8 0xb7c90220 in K3bProjectBurnDialog::prepareGui() () from /usr/lib/libk3bproject.so.2 #9 0xb7cdc30b in K3bDvdBurnDialog::K3bDvdBurnDialog(K3bDvdDoc*, QWidget*, char const*, bool) () from /usr/lib/libk3bproject.so.2 #10 0xb7cd901a in K3bDvdDoc::newBurnDialog(QWidget*, char const*) () from /usr/lib/libk3bproject.so.2 #11 0xb7cbc4f9 in K3bDataDoc::slotBurn() () from /usr/lib/libk3bproject.so.2 #12 0xb7cbc7b1 in K3bDataDoc::qt_invoke(int, QUObject*) () from /usr/lib/libk3bproject.so.2 #13 0xb6ed6b9f in QObject::activate_signal(QConnectionList*, QUObject*) () from /usr/qt/3/lib/libqt-mt.so.3 #14 0xb6ed6a3f in QObject::activate_signal(int) () from /usr/qt/3/lib/libqt-mt.so.3 #15 0xb7244247 in QButton::clicked() () from /usr/qt/3/lib/libqt-mt.so.3 #16 0xb6f6beea in QButton::mouseReleaseEvent(QMouseEvent*) () from /usr/qt/3/lib/libqt-mt.so.3 #17 0xb6f0efa1 in QWidget::event(QEvent*) () from /usr/qt/3/lib/libqt-mt.so.3 #18 0xb6e7385d in QApplication::internalNotify(QObject*, QEvent*) () from /usr/qt/3/lib/libqt-mt.so.3 #19 0xb6e72e6e in QApplication::notify(QObject*, QEvent*) () from /usr/qt/3/lib/libqt-mt.so.3 #20 0xb74706d2 in KApplication::notify(QObject*, QEvent*) () from /usr/kde/3.4/lib/libkdecore.so.4 #21 0xb6e085f2 in QApplication::sendSpontaneousEvent(QObject*, QEvent*) () from /usr/qt/3/lib/libqt-mt.so.3 #22 0xb6e00ec8 in QETWidget::translateMouseEvent(_XEvent const*) () from /usr/qt/3/lib/libqt-mt.so.3 #23 0xb6dfe9a2 in QApplication::x11ProcessEvent(_XEvent*) () from /usr/qt/3/lib/libqt-mt.so.3 #24 0xb6e19a00 in QEventLoop::processEvents(unsigned) () from /usr/qt/3/lib/libqt-mt.so.3 #25 0xb6e87dd7 in QEventLoop::enterLoop() () from /usr/qt/3/lib/libqt-mt.so.3 #26 0xb6e87cee in QEventLoop::exec() () from /usr/qt/3/lib/libqt-mt.so.3 #27 0xb6e739cb in QApplication::exec() () from /usr/qt/3/lib/libqt-mt.so.3 #28 0x080a0d6f in QPtrList<K3bPluginFactory>::deleteItem(void*) () #29 0xb699d62e in __libc_start_main () from /lib/libc.so.6 #30 0x0807eea1 in ?? () --------------------------- cut --------------------------- Output of "emerge info": ---------------------------- cut -------------------------- Portage 2.0.51.19 (default-linux/x86/2005.0, gcc-3.3.5-20050130, glibc-2.3.4.20041102-r1, 2.6.11-gentoo-r4 i686) ================================================================= System uname: 2.6.11-gentoo-r4 i686 AMD Duron(tm) Processor Gentoo Base System version 1.4.16 Python: dev-lang/python-2.3.4-r1 [2.3.4 (#1, Mar 19 2005, 19:00:42)] dev-lang/python: 2.3.4-r1 sys-devel/autoconf: 2.13, 2.59-r6 sys-devel/automake: 1.7.9-r1, 1.5, 1.9.4, 1.6.3, 1.4_p6, 1.8.5-r3 sys-devel/binutils: 2.15.92.0.2-r7 sys-devel/libtool: 1.5.14 virtual/os-headers: 2.6.8.1-r2 ACCEPT_KEYWORDS="x86" AUTOCLEAN="yes" CFLAGS="-mcpu=athlon -pipe" CHOST="i686-pc-linux-gnu" C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3.4/env /usr/kde/3.4/share/config /usr/kde/3.4/shutdown /usr/kde/3/share/config /usr/lib/X11/xkb /usr/share/config /usr/share/texmf/dvipdfm/config/ /usr/share/texmf/dvips/config/ /usr/share/texmf/tex/generic/config/ /usr/share/texmf/tex/platex/config/ /usr/share/texmf/xdvi/ /var/qmail/control" CONFIG_PROTECT_MASK="/etc/gconf /etc/terminfo /etc/env.d" CXXFLAGS="-mcpu=athlon -pipe" DISTDIR="/usr/portage/distfiles" FEATURES="autoaddcvs autoconfig ccache distlocks sandbox sfperms strict" GENTOO_MIRRORS="ftp://pandemonium.tiscali.de/pub/gentoo/ http://pandemonium.tiscali.de/pub/gentoo/ http://mirrors.sec.informatik.tu-darmstadt.de/gentoo/ ftp://212.219.56.146/sites/www.ibiblio.org/gentoo/" LANG="de_DE@euro" LINGUAS="de en" MAKEOPTS="-j2" PKGDIR="/usr/portage/packages" PORTAGE_TMPDIR="/var/tmp" PORTDIR="/usr/portage" SYNC="rsync://rsync.gentoo.org/gentoo-portage" USE="x86 X alsa apm arts avi berkdb bitmap-fonts bri cdr crypt cups curl dga doc dvd dvdr emboss encode esd fam foomaticdb fortran ftp gdbm gif gnome gpm gtk gtk2 imagemagick imlib ipv6 jpeg kde libg++ libwww lm_sensors mad mikmod mmx motif mozilla mp3 mpeg mysql ncurses nls ogg oggvorbis opengl oss pam pdflib perl png ppds pri python qt quicktime readline sdl slang spell ssl svga sysfs tcpd tetex tiff truetype truetype-fonts type1-fonts usb vorbis xml2 xmms xv zaptel zlib linguas_de linguas_en" Unset: ASFLAGS, CBUILD, CTARGET, LC_ALL, LDFLAGS, PORTDIR_OVERLAY ---------------------------- cut --------------------------
Additional info which may be significant: The PC does not have a DVD writer, only a DVD reader. The intention is to create an iso image to be burned somewhere else.
You didn't report the version of k3b, but I assume it was this bug: http://bugs.kde.org/show_bug.cgi?id=97801
Ok, sorry i forgot. This report is for version 0.11.18 (latest stable). Confirmed with version 0.11.23 (-r2 does not compile, k3b-dvdrip-transcode.patch does not apply cleanly). So, i think 0.11.23 should go stable (~x86 -> x86).